About Blue Planet Energy Systems

Blue Planet Energy Systems operates as a scalable energy platform. It offers a self-contained energy storage package that combines battery technology with architecture and software. It was founded in 2015 and is based in Honolulu, Hawaii.

Henk Rogers’ energy storage systems see swift sales in Hawaii and beyond

Aug 6, 2015

Courtesy Blue Planet Energy Systems LLC Blue Planet Energy Systems' Blue Ion battery energy storage system is now available for… more Hawaii serial entrepreneur Henk Rogers ’ energy storage company, which was formed in partnership with Sony Electronics Inc. and is aimed at ultimately getting homeowners off the electrical grid, has seen swift sales since officially beginning the process last weekend, Rogers told PBN. “We have been inundated with inquiries from Hawaii and around the world,” he told PBN in an email. “We are pleased that the demand is high for our battery storage system. We’re also excited to be announcing shortly our new vice president of sales.” Rogers and his business partners, Vincent Paul Ponthieux and Aleks Velhner , formed Blue Planet Energy Systems LLC, to create the “Blue Ion,” a self-contained energy storage package that combines Sony’s lithium ion battery technology with Blue Planet Energy’s proprietary architecture and software. The system is designed to be quickly and easily installed and have a low, simple payback, although pricing of the system has yet to be revealed. No pricing of these systems has yet been divulged, as Blue Planet Energy prices its systems per each installation, Rogers said. “Most other companies have pre-set packages where one size fits all, but none of these companies are trying to have homes go off the grid,” he said. “In our case we are customizing the systems to take homes off the grid. This requires a very different approach since each installation has unique requirements.” Blue Ion has been utilized by Rogers at his Honolulu home and at his Big Island ranch. On Fourth of July weekend, Rogers celebrated his first anniversary of energy independence — a completely off-the-grid 6,000-square-foot home in Honolulu — by announcing this venture, which he hopes will help more homeowners do the same. Sparkion

Sparkion is a company that focuses on energy management solutions in the energy sector. The company offers a suite of energy management software that optimizes the use of distributed energy resources, including storage, solar, and electric vehicle charging, and provides AI-driven prediction tools to reduce demand charges, making sites more cost-effective and profitable. Sparkion primarily sells to sectors such as fueling stations, fleet operators, retail and hospitality, automotive dealers, and workplaces. It is based in Herzliya, Israel.

FreeWire Technologies

FreeWire Technologies operates as an intelligent energy system platform for the industry's needs of energy and transportation. It creates energy delivery systems brings clean power to applications and manufactures electric vehicle charging solutions that free customers from the limitations of the electric grid. The company was founded in 2014 and is based in Newark, California.

Electric Era

Electric Era offers charging stations for electric vehicles. It provides infrastructure and the battery storage product PowerNode. It was formerly known as Lync Technologies. The company was founded in 2019 and is based in Seattle, Washington.

Energport

Energport is a supplier of integrated energy storage systems leveraging automotive-grade lithium-iron phosphate battery cells. It offers indoor energy storage, outdoor container series, utility-scale solutions, and battery DC blocks. It was founded in 2016 and is based in Fremont, California.

Veloce Energy

Veloce Energy offers a hardware and software infrastructure platform to deploy and operate electric vehicle (EV) charging stations and commercial and solar storage. Its interoperable charging station infrastructure utilizes open standards and enables EV station operators, fleets, site hosts, and utilities to manage electric vehicle charging and other loads. The company was founded in 2018 and is based in Los Angeles, California.

ADS-TEC Energy

ADS-TEC Energy is a company that focuses on battery-supported platform solutions in the energy sector. The company's main offerings include battery storage systems and charging solutions, which are used for ultra-fast charging of electric vehicles and industrial applications, such as optimizing self-consumption and capping peak loads. The company primarily sells to the electric mobility industry and the renewable energy sector. It is based in Nurtingen, Germany.
